Aller au sommaire principal

ULB - Université libre de Bruxelles

 

AIDE | QUITTER

   

Année académique 2017-2018
24/05/2019
Image transparente
Dernière modification : le 05/01/2016 par MARKOWITCH, Olivier

Langue/Language


Introduction to cryptography
INFO - F405

I. Informations générales
Intitulé de l'unité d'enseignement * Introduction to cryptography
Langue d'enseignement * Enseigné en anglais
Niveau du cadre de certification * Niveau 7 (2e cycle-MA/MS/MA60)
Discipline * Informatique
Titulaire(s) * [y inclus le coordonnateur] Olivier MARKOWITCH (coordonnateur)
II. Place de l'enseignement
Unité(s) d'enseignement co-requise(s) *
Unité(s) d'enseignement pré-requise(s) *
Connaissances et compétences pré-requises * Notions de base de mathématiques discrètes et d'informatique fondamentale : architecture des systèmes, réseaux, algorithmique et complexité.
Programme(s) d'études comprenant l'unité d'enseignement - M-INFOS - Master en sciences informatiques (5 crédits, obligatoire)
- M-IREMG - Master en ingénieur civil électromécanicien, à finalité Gestion et technologies (5 crédits, optionnel)
- M-IRIFS - Master en ingénieur civil en informatique, à finalité spécialisée (5 crédits, obligatoire)
- M-SECUC - Master en cybersécurité, à finalité Conception et Analyse de Systèmes (5 crédits, obligatoire)
- M-SECUS - Master en cybersécurité, à finalité Stratégies en entreprise (5 crédits, obligatoire)
III. Objectifs et méthodologies
Contribution de l'unité d'enseignement au profil d'enseignement *

Acquérir des connaissances pointues dans son domaine, agir en acteur expert scientifique dans des résolutions de problèmes, communiquer dans un langage adapté au contexte et à son public, se développer professionnellement dans un souci du respect des questions éthiques liées à son domaine d’expertise.

Objectifs de l'unité d'enseignement (et/ou acquis d'apprentissages spécifiques) *

Comprendre les différents concepts de la sécurité informatique. Comprendre les algorithmes et protocoles cryptographiques usuels. Connaître les limites d'usage et d'inter-opérabilité de ces différents mécanismes.

Contenu de l'unité d'enseignement *

Éléments d'histoire de la cryptologie et de la sécurité informatique. Le chiffrement symétrique et asymétrique, l'intégrité, l'identification, le hachage, les signatures digitales et la gestion des clés. Outils, algorithmes et logiciels usuels (PGP...). Eléments de sécurité des réseaux.

Méthodes d'enseignement et activités d'apprentissages *

Cours, exercices et réalisation de projet

Support(s) de cours indispensable(s) * Oui (1)
Autres supports de cours
Références, bibliographie et lectures recommandées *

Dieter Gollman, « Computer Security », 2d ed., Wiley et Sons, 2005. Alfred J. Menezes, Paul C. van Oorschot et Scott A. Vanstone, « Handbook of Applied Cryptography », CRC Press, 1997.

IV. Evaluation
Méthode(s) d'évaluation *

Réalisation de travaux personnel. Important : l'assiduité aux travaux pratiques et au travaux personnels est un critère nécessaire de réussite

Construction de la note (en ce compris, la pondération des notes partielles) *

Evaluation par la réalisation de projets suivis de défenses orales.

Langue d'évaluation *

French or English

V. Organisation pratique
Institution organisatrice * ULB
Faculté gestionnaire * Sciences
Quadrimestre * Premier quadrimestre (NRE : 18353)
Horaire * Premier quadrimestre
Volume horaire
VI. Coordination pédagogique
Contact *

Olivier Markowitch Département d'Informatique - CP212 Campus Plaine - Bâtiment N/O, bureaux 2.N8.115A olivier.markowitch@ulb.ac.be

Lieu d’enseignement *

ULB

VII. Autres informations relatives à l’unité d’enseignement
Remarques

Retour aux détails du cursus
Image transparente
Passer directement au début de la page
Version: 8.1.1.17